Define equilibrium constant of a reaction.What is the unit of equilibrium constant.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

Equilibrium constnat `(K_(c)` is defined as the ratioi of product of equilibrium concentrations of products to the product of equilibrium concentrations of reactants each concentration term being raised to its stoichiometric coefficient.
Consider the following reaction at equilibrium.
`aA+bBhArrcC+dD`
Applying law of mass action
`R_(f) prop [A]^(b)[B]^(b)" "R_(f)=K_(f)[A]^(a)[B]^(b)`
`R_(b)prop[C]^(c)[D]^(d)" "R_(b)=K_(b)[C]^(c)[D]^(4)`
At equilibrium `R_(f)=R_(b)`
`K_(f)[A]^(a)[B]^(b)=K_(b)[C]^(c)[D]^(d)`
`K_(C)=(K_(f))/(K_(b))=([C]^(c)[D]^(d))/([A]^(a)[B]^(b))`
